don't busy retry the inode on failed grab_super_passive()
This fixes a soft lockup on conditions
a) the flusher is working on a work by __bdi_start_writeback(), while
b) someone else calls writeback_inodes_sb*() or sync_inodes_sb(), which
grab sb->s_umount and enqueue a new work for the flusher to execute
The s_umount grabbed by (b) will fail the grab_super_passive() in (a).
Then if the inode is requeued, wb_writeback() will busy retry on it.
As a result, wb_writeback() loops for ever without releasing
wb->list_lock, which further blocks other tasks.
Fix the busy loop by redirtying the inode. This may undesirably delay
the writeback of the inode, however most likely it will be picked up
soon by the queued work by writeback_inodes_sb*(), sync_inodes_sb() or
even writeback_inodes_wb().

kconfig: Introduce IS_ENABLED(), IS_BUILTIN() and IS_MODULE()
Replace the config_is_*() macros with a variant that allows for grepping
for usage of CONFIG_* options in the code. Usage:
if (IS_ENABLED(CONFIG_NUMA))
or
#if IS_ENABLED(CONFIG_NUMA)
The IS_ENABLED() macro evaluates to 1 if the argument is set (to either 'y'
or 'm'), IS_BUILTIN() tests if the option is 'y' and IS_MODULE() test if
the option is 'm'. Only boolean and tristate options are supported.

Kernel keyring keys containing eCryptfs authentication tokens should not
be write locked when calling out to ecryptfsd to wrap and unwrap file
encryption keys. The eCryptfs kernel code can not hold the key's write
lock because ecryptfsd needs to request the key after receiving such a
request from the kernel.
Without this fix, all file opens and creates will timeout and fail when
using the eCryptfs PKI infrastructure. This is not an issue when using
passphrase-based mount keys, which is the most widely deployed eCryptfs
configuration.

Some PMBus chips have non-standard sensor registers. An easy way to
support such sensors is to introduce virtual pages and map the non-standard
registers into standard registers on an extra page.
For this to work, the code verifying if the configured number of pages exists
has to be removed. Since a wrong number of pages can only be configured in a
front-end driver, this should not have a practical impact since the resulting
errors should be found during development and testing.
Also, functions to read the chip status while checking if a command register
exists must be modified to no longer set the page register before reading the
status, since the physical page associated with the checked register may not
exist. This does not make a functional difference since the page was already set
when the attempt to read the register was made.

[media] tda18271c2dd: Fix saw filter configuration for DVB-C @6MHz
Currently, the driver assumes that all QAM carriers are spaced with
8MHz. This is wrong, and may decrease QoS on Countries like Brazil,
that have DVB-C carriers with 6MHz-spaced.
Fortunately, both ITU-T J-83 and EN 300 429 specifies a way to
associate the symbol rate with the bandwidth needed for it.
For ITU-T J-83 2007 annex A, the maximum symbol rate for 6 MHz is:
6 MHz / 1.15 = 5217391 Bauds
For ITU-T J-83 2007 annex C, the maximum symbol rate for 6 MHz is:
6 MHz / 1.13 = 5309735 Bauds.
As this tuner is currently used only for DRX-K, and it is currently
hard-coded to annex A, I've opted to use the roll-off factor of 0.15,
instead of 0.13.
If we ever support annex C, the better would be to add a DVB S2API
call to allow changing between Annex A and C, and add the 0.13 roll-off
factor to it.
This code is currently being used on other frontends, so I think we
should later add a core function with this code, to warrant that
it will be properly implemented everywhere.

[SCSI] libfc: Remove the reference to FCP packet from scsi_cmnd in case of error
fc_queuecommand() allocates an FCP packet for each SCSI command and sends
it out on the wire. In the process it stores the reference to the FCP packet
in the scsi_cmnd structure.
Now, in case under stress testing the libfc exchange layer runs out of
exchanges the fc_queuecommand() may not be able to send out commands out on
the wire. In such a scenario if there is an error in sending the FCP packet
out the wire; fc_queuecommand() deletes the FCP packet from internal queue,
releases the FCP packet and returns a SCSI_MLQUEUE_HOST_BUSY status to the
scsi-ml. But, the reference to the FCP packet set in the scsi_cmnd is not
removed from the scsi_cmnd in this code path.
This might lead to a crash under stress testing where the scsi_cmnd failed by
fc_queuecommand() comes up to fc_eh_abort() via scsi eh thread. fc_eh_abort()
will get reference to the FCP packet to be aborted from the scsi_cmnd for
further FCP abort related processing and then try to release the FCP packet
that has already been released.
This patch removes the FCP packet reference from the scsi_cmnd before returning
back from fc_queuecommand() in case of an error in sending out the FCP packet.

[SCSI] dh_rdac: Associate HBA and storage in rdac_controller to support partitions in storage
rdac hardware handler assumes that there is one-to-one relation ship
between the host and the controller w.r.t lun. IOW, it does not
support "multiple storage partitions" within a storage.
Example:
HBA1 and HBA2 see lun 0 and 1 in storage A (1)
HBA3 and HBA4 see lun 0 and 1 in storage A (2)
HBA5 and HBA6 see lun 0 and 1 in storage A (3)
luns 0 and 1 in (1), (2) and (3) are totally different.
But, rdac handler treats the lun 0s (and lun 1s) as the same when
sending a mode select to the controller, which is wrong.
This patch makes the rdac hardware handler associate HBA and the
storage w.r.t lun (and not the host itself).

Grant Likely [Tue, 26 Jul 2011 09:19:06 +0000 (03:19 -0600)]
irq: add irq_domain translation infrastructure
This patch adds irq_domain infrastructure for translating from
hardware irq numbers to linux irqs. This is particularly important
for architectures adding device tree support because the current
implementation (excluding PowerPC and SPARC) cannot handle
translation for more than a single interrupt controller. irq_domain
supports device tree translation for any number of interrupt
controllers.
This patch converts x86, Microblaze, ARM and MIPS to use irq_domain
for device tree irq translation. x86 is untested beyond compiling it,
irq_domain is enabled for MIPS and Microblaze, but the old behaviour is
preserved until the core code is modified to actually register an
irq_domain yet. On ARM it works and is required for much of the new
ARM device tree board support.
PowerPC has /not/ been converted to use this new infrastructure. It
is still missing some features before it can replace the virq
infrastructure already in powerpc (see documentation on
irq_domain_map/unmap for details). Followup patches will add the
missing pieces and migrate PowerPC to use irq_domain.
SPARC has its own method of managing interrupts from the device tree
and is unaffected by this change.
Durgadoss R [Tue, 12 Jul 2011 11:07:16 +0000 (07:07 -0400)]
hwmon: (coretemp) Add core/pkg threshold support to Coretemp
This patch adds the core and pkg support to coretemp.
These thresholds can be configured via the sysfs interfaces tempX_max
and tempX_max_hyst. An interrupt is generated when CPU temperature reaches
or crosses above tempX_max OR drops below tempX_max_hyst.
This patch is based on the documentation in IA Manual vol 3A, that can be
